Is it good to give your dog probiotics?

Yes, giving your dog probiotics can be beneficial by supporting their digestive health, boosting their immune system, and improving nutrient absorption.

Are Probiotics Good for Dogs? A Comprehensive Guide

Probiotics have become increasingly popular in pet wellness, particularly for dogs. But many pet owners still wonder: Is it good to give your dog probiotics? The answer is generally yes, but with some important considerations.

What Are Probiotics?

Probiotics are live microorganisms—mainly bacteria and certain yeasts—that provide health benefits when consumed in adequate amounts. They’re often referred to as "good bacteria" because they help support a healthy gut environment.

Benefits of Probiotics for Dogs

Giving your dog probiotics can offer several important health benefits:
  • Improved Digestive Health: Probiotics can help maintain a balanced gut microbiome, which aids in proper digestion and nutrient absorption.
  • Reduced Gastrointestinal Issues: Dogs suffering from diarrhea, constipation, bloating, or gas often benefit from probiotic supplementation.
  • Boosted Immune System: A large portion of a dog’s immune system resides in their gut, and probiotics help reinforce these defenses.
  • Better Nutrient Absorption: A healthy gut facilitates more efficient absorption of vitamins, minerals, and other nutrients.
  • Reduced Allergies and Skin Conditions: Some studies suggest that probiotics may help alleviate allergic reactions and enhance skin health.

Types of Probiotics for Dogs

Not all probiotics are the same. Here are the common types typically used for dogs:
  • Lactobacillus: Promotes digestion and supports gut flora balance.
  • Bifidobacterium: Helps by enhancing immune function and preventing pathogens from taking hold.
  • Enterococcus: Known for reducing diarrhea and promoting healthy gut function.

Sources of Probiotics for Dogs

There are several ways you can introduce probiotics into your dog’s diet:
  1. Probiotic Supplements: Specially formulated capsules, powders, or chews designed for dogs. These often contain specific strains beneficial to canine health.
  2. Probiotic-Enriched Foods: Some high-quality dog foods include added probiotics in their formulas.
  3. Naturally Fermented Foods: Foods like yogurt, kefir, and sauerkraut may contain probiotics, although they should only be given in moderation and with caution since not all human foods are safe for dogs.

When to Give Probiotics

Probiotics can be beneficial in different scenarios:
  • After a course of antibiotics that may have disrupted the gut flora.
  • If your dog suffers from chronic digestive issues.
  • To support overall wellness and immunity, especially in puppies or senior dogs.

Choosing the Right Probiotic

When selecting a probiotic for your dog, consider the following factors:
  • Strain Diversity: Look for supplements with multiple strains for broader benefits.
  • Guaranteed CFUs: Colony Forming Units (CFUs) indicate the amount of live bacteria. A higher count is often more effective.
  • Veterinary Recommendation: Always consult with your vet to choose the most suitable probiotic, especially if your dog has health issues.

Possible Side Effects

Though generally safe, probiotics may cause minor side effects in some dogs, including:
  • Temporary gas or bloating
  • Mild diarrhea during the adjustment period
If symptoms persist or worsen, discontinue use and consult your veterinarian.

Conclusion

Adding probiotics to your dog’s routine can greatly benefit their digestive and immune health. Always select products designed for dogs, introduce them gradually, and consult your vet for best results. With the right probiotic, your pup can lead a healthier, happier life.
